Match Summary: KKR vs KXIP - IPL 2019, Match 7
In an exhilarating encounter at the iconic Eden Gardens on March 28, 2019, Kolkata Knight Riders (KKR) showcased their batting prowess against Kings XI Punjab (KXIP), ultimately securing victory by 28 runs.
KKR batted first, posting a formidable total of 218 runs for the loss of 4 wickets in their allotted 20 overs. The standout performance came from Robin Uthappa, who played a blistering innings of 67 runs off 50 balls, including 6 boundaries and 2 sixes, achieving an impressive strike rate of 134.00. Nitish Rana also made significant contributions with a rapid 63 runs off just 34 balls, hitting 2 fours and 7 sixes at a staggering strike rate of 185.29. Andre Russell added a quickfire 48 runs, showcasing his explosive batting style with 3 fours and 5 sixes, scoring at an eye-popping strike rate of 282.35. The Knights' total was bolstered further by Sunil Narine's quick 24 runs off just 9 deliveries at a strike rate of 266.66.
KXIP, in response, managed to score 190 runs with all four wickets down in their 20 overs. Mayank Agarwal top-scored for the Kings, contributing 58 runs off 34 balls with 6 fours and 1 six, followed by David Miller, who remained unbeaten on 59 runs off 40 balls, striking 5 fours and 3 sixes to keep his team in the contest. However, despite a valiant effort, KXIP fell short of the target.
From the bowling side, Andre Russell stood out with the ball as well, claiming 2 wickets for just 21 runs in 3 overs, while Lockie Ferguson took 1 wicket for 42 runs in his spell. The rest of the bowling attack, including Kuldeep Yadav and Piyush Chawla, managed to contain the runs effectively.
Match Result: Kolkata Knight Riders defeated Kings XI Punjab by 28 runs, highlighting their batting depth and bowling discipline.
